Advantages of Easy-to-Grow Cannabis Seeds:
High Germination Rates: Easy-to-grow cannabis seeds are typically selected for their high germination rates, which means that a higher percentage of seeds will successfully sprout into healthy cannabis plants. This can give beginner growers the confidence and assurance that their efforts will yield positive results.
Resilience and Hardiness: Easy-to-grow cannabis seeds are often chosen for strains that are known for their resilience and hardiness. These strains can tolerate a wide range of growing conditions, including fluctuations in temperature, humidity, and light levels, making them more forgiving for beginners who may not have precise control over their growing environment.
Shorter Flowering Times: Easy-to-grow cannabis seeds are often bred for strains that have shorter flowering times. This means that the plants will mature and produce buds more quickly, allowing growers to enjoy the fruits of their labor in a shorter amount of time. This can be particularly beneficial for beginners who may be eager to see results sooner rather than later.
Low Maintenance Requirements: Easy-to-grow cannabis seeds are typically selected for strains that have low maintenance requirements, making them ideal for beginner growers who may have limited time, space, or resources. These strains may require less frequent watering, feeding, and pruning, which can make the cultivation process more manageable for beginners.
Resistance to Pests and Diseases: Easy-to-grow cannabis seeds are often bred for strains that have natural resistance to common pests and diseases. This can reduce the risk of infestations and infections, making the cultivation process easier and less stressful for beginner growers who may not have experience in dealing with these issues.
Tips for Cultivating Cannabis from Easy-to-Grow Seeds:
Choose the Right Strain: When selecting easy-to-grow cannabis seeds, it’s important to choose strains that are well-suited for your specific growing conditions, such as climate, space, and available resources. Look for strains that are known for their resilience, short flowering times, and low maintenance requirements. Popular strains for beginners include Northern Lights, White Widow, and Blue Dream.
Provide Optimal Growing Conditions: Even with easy-to-grow cannabis seeds, it’s important to provide optimal growing conditions for your plants. This includes providing the right amount of light, temperature, humidity, and airflow. Invest in quality grow lights, monitor and control temperature and humidity levels, and ensure proper ventilation in your grow space.
Use Quality Soil and Nutrients: Cannabis plants rely on nutrient-rich soil for their growth and development. Use high-quality soil and consider adding organic nutrients to provide your plants with the essential elements they need to thrive. Avoid overfeeding, as it can cause nutrient burn and other issues.
Water Properly: Proper watering is crucial for cannabis cultivation. Overwatering or underwatering can lead to problems such as root rot or nutrient deficiencies. Water your plants when the top inch of the soil feels dry and be mindful of drainage to prevent water from pooling in the pot.
Prune and Train Your Plants: Pruning and training your cannabis plants can help promote healthy growth and maximize yields. Remove any dead or yellowing leaves, and consider using techniques such as topping or LST (low-stress training) to control the shape and size of your plants.
